A Rayners Lane pub has been recognised for the quality of its real ale.
Members of the Campaign for Real Ale (CAMRA) branch listed The Village Inn in the 2017 Good Beer Guide, published earlier this month.
It is the only pub in Rayners Lane to be listed in the guide and manager Elizabeth Hutber said she "delighted" at the news.
Ms Hutber said: “Staff at the pub work hard to ensure that the real ales on offer are kept in first-class condition at all times and the pub’s inclusion in the guide highlights this.
“We offer our customers an excellent range of real ales at all times, including those from regional brewers and microbrewers, as well as hosting our own beer festivals.”
